Well ATM actually means asynchronous transfer mode and is often defined as a traditional cell based switching method that especially makes the use of asynchronous time division multiplexing which enables encoding of unique data into definite sized cells or cell relay and provides distinct data link layer services that specifically run on OSI Layer 1 physical links. Most often individuals mistake it for packet switched networks like the Internet Protocol or Ethernet where varying sized small-scale packets are utilized for data transport.
ATM or asynchronous transfer mode generally possesses properties of two varieties of networking. This means that it can be employed in both circuit switched as well as packet switched networking. This enables it to operate as the best means of a wide variety of data transfer. It is also quite appropriate for real time media transport. The model which is especially employed in this specific method of data transfer is primarily connection oriented, thus readily linking both end points with virtual circuit even before the data starting to transmit.
Asynchronous transfer mode technology can easily be employed for mainly LAN and WAN links. ATM additionally has several other unique capabilities that are discussed in brief as listed here:
It has the possibility of delivering a data transfer speed of as much as 2.5 GBps which easily helps to enable high bandwidth distributed programs. This is generally useful for video-on-demand methods or video conferencing that are commonly dependent on new distributed applications. It additionally enables access to remote databases including multimedia data.
As far as traffic is concerned, asynchronous transfer mode particularly uses a virtual network for driving data within different sites. Besides point to point communications, ATM is also useful where an individual transmitter and multiple receiver services are involved because of its multicasting capability.
